Dalmore Slipover
Pattern description from The Celtic Collection: “The pattern on this slipover is taken from a single border on an illuminated manuscript from Lindisfarne, a tiny island off the coast of Northumberland, North East England. The regular character of the border makes it an excellent Fair Isle design - one that can be repeated across the width of the knitting and for the length of the fabric. Worked here in a subtle mix of tweed and silk and wool yarns, this garment will be popular with both men and women.”
Knitted Measurements:
- To fit bust/chest 86-92 (102-107) cm/34-36 (40-42)“
- Underarm 102 (114) cm/40 (45)“
- Length from top of shoulder 57 (63) cm/22½ (24¾)“
Materials:
- Yarn: Rowan Donegal Lambswool Tweed; Silk/Wool; Silkstones; Wool/Cotton
- A. Pickle Donegal Tweed (483) 50(70)g; B. Bramble Donegal Tweed (484) 50g; C. Elderberry Donegal Tweed (490) 50g; D. Sapphire Donegal Tweed (486) 25g; E. Roseberry Donegal Tweed (480) 25g; F. Pine Silk/Wool (860) 40g; G. Moss Green Silk/Wool (852) 40g; H. Donkey Silk/Wool (856) 40(60)g; I. Silkstones Dried Rose (825) 50g; J. Mulberry Silkstones (836) 50g; K. Musk Wool/Cotton (913) 80g
- One set of double pointed or circular needles in 2¾mm (US2) and 3¼mm (US3) needles.
- 3 stitch holders
- Stitch markers
- Safety pin
- 1 Darner
The original yarns are discontinued and may be substituted.
